Seeking Guidance: Alternative Phrases for Requesting Advice

When seeking guidance or advice, it’s important to use polite and respectful language to convey your request effectively. Here are some alternative phrases you can use to enhance your communication skills:

1. “I would greatly appreciate your expertise on…”
This phrase shows that you value the person’s knowledge and are specifically seeking their input. It also sets a polite tone for the conversation.

2. “Could you please offer your insights regarding…”
By using the word “insights,” you are indicating that you value the person’s unique perspective and are open to their suggestions. It also adds a touch of professionalism to your request.

3. “I’m seeking guidance on…”
This straightforward phrase clearly states that you are in need of advice. It conveys your desire to learn and grow, making it more likely for others to offer their assistance.

4. “I respect your expertise and would like to seek your counsel on…”
This expression acknowledges the person’s knowledge and positions them as an authority figure. It shows that you value their opinion and are actively seeking their guidance.

Remember, when requesting advice, it’s important to approach the conversation with humility, respect, and an open mind. These alternative phrases can help you establish a positive rapport and encourage others to share their insights more willingly.

Asking for Input: Polite Expressions to Seek Suggestions

When seeking input or suggestions, it is important to use polite and respectful language to make the request. By doing so, you create a positive and collaborative atmosphere that encourages others to share their ideas. Instead of simply saying “What do you think?”, try using phrases such as “I would greatly appreciate your input on this matter” or “I value your perspective and would love to hear your suggestions.” These statements convey your respect for the other person’s opinion and show that you are open to their ideas.

Another way to seek suggestions politely is by using phrases that express gratitude and acknowledge the expertise of the person you are asking. For instance, you can say “I admire your experience in this area and would welcome any suggestions you may have” or “Your input would be highly valuable to me, given your knowledge on this subject.” These phrases demonstrate your recognition of the other person’s expertise and make them feel valued for their contributions. Remember, a polite request for input not only shows your professionalism but also encourages others to actively engage in the conversation.
